访问电脑版页面

导航:老古开发网手机版其他

基于LabVIEW的空调参数测量

导读:
关键字:

空调市场经过几年的价格大战,以及钢,铜,铝,塑料等原材料价格的不断上扬,使得空调的利润率越来越低。为了维持利润,空调厂家纷纷大举扩大产能,严格控制成本,积极开发新产品。

对于新产品开发,为了依靠新产品特别是高端产品的高附加值来获取高利润,采用低成本、高时效性和高稳定性的测试系统开发新机型、新技术就显得非常必要。采用美国NI公司的LabVIEW图形开发软件,利用PXI高速稳定的采集卡以及简单的接口电路完成空调各项参数的测量,其优势非常明显。这套系统组成简单、性能可靠、开发周期短,这些特点对于开发新产品,验证和测试控制逻辑,加快空调测试和研发速度,节省实验成本都有着重要的意义。

LabVIEW图形软件和PXI总线概述

LabVIEW是美国National Instruments(简称NI)公司推出的一个图形化软件开发环境,它是一个通用的软件开发平台,不仅在一般的数据管理、科学计算等方面可以开发出优秀的应用程序,其最大优势还在于测控系统的开发。因为它不仅提供了几乎所有经典的信号处理函数和大量现代的高级信号分析工具,而且LabVIEW程序还很容易和各种数据采集硬件集成,可以和多种主流的工业现场总线通信以及与大多数通用标准的实时数据库链接。


图1:基于LabVIEW的空调参数测量系统框图

PXI,即PCI extensions for Instrumentation,具有Compact PCI总线的机械特性,并具有专为测量应用的同步/触发/时钟总线信号。PXI规范于1997年出台,经过几年的发展,目前已广泛应用在军工、汽车测试、半导体测试、功能性测试、航空设备测试等领域。从技术角度上讲,PXI具有三大优势:第一点,速度变化快。由于基于PCI总线,所以适合大量数据交换,速度比较快,在生产线上测试同样功能所需要的时间更短;第二点,体积小,比如传统的空调参数测量,需要很大的一套设备,现在只需要一台PXI机箱就可以了;第三点,性能非常可靠,使用户免受使用过程中设备停机的困扰。

参数测量系统介绍

本设计目的是希望利用LabVIEW的软件开发平台和PXI系列采集板卡,以及传感器采集的信号完成对空调常用参数的测量、处理及存储显示等功能。通过对这些参数的长期监测来验证空调的控制逻辑,以及空调系统的性能。

整个系统由两部分组成:一部分是信号检测和变换部分,它由若干现场监测传感器和信号变换电路组成;另一部分是采集板卡和检测软件部分,它主要由采集板卡、工控机和基于工控机的监控软件组成,系统框图如图1所示。

信号检测和变换部分,主要由若干现场监测传感器和信号变换电路组成,这些检测量一般包括多路(蒸发器、冷凝器、排气管等)温度信号、湿度信号、多路(冷凝压力、蒸发压力)压力信号及多路开关量输入输出信号的检测和信号变换等;另一部分是采集板卡和检测软件部分,它主要由采集板卡、工控机和基于工控机的监控软件组成,完成对信号的处理、显示、存储、查询等功能。

硬件设计

硬件设计主要包括各点温度、湿度、压力、电流、电压及开关量输入输出信号等参数的检测和变换电路。
空调行业温度的检测现在一般采用热电偶和热敏电阻,本设计以热敏电阻为例,介绍温度测量的过程。具体检测电路如图2所示,通过这个电路可以把温度信号转换为模拟电压信号,然后利用工控机的软件把对应电压反变换为所代表的温度量,并通过温度计样的图形界面形象地显示出来。


图2:热敏电阻测温电路


图3:交流电压开关量检测电路

湿度、压力及电流、电压信号的检测类似于温度信号的检测,在此不多做说明。

开关量的状态也是空调中检测和验证控制的重要参数,它可分为高电压交流信号和低电压直流信号。强电交流信号一般是110~220V,50Hz或60Hz的交流电压信号,可以采用图3的检测电路实现信号的半波整流、限流、滤波、光耦隔离并转换为TTL的反逻辑,然后通过采集板卡和软件编程实现信号的采集和显示。对于低压直流信号直接采用光耦隔离就可以得到符合TTL电平的电信号,经过采集板卡和软件编程实现开关状态在界面上的信号灯的明灭显示。

本设计中采用的采集板卡是NI公司的NI PXI6071E,它具有TTL/CMOS电平兼容的64路模拟输入接口,1路DAC输出接口,8路双向数字接口和4个定时/计数器接口,并且是PXI标准接口,可以实现各种信号的接收和检测。

软件设计

软件采用LabVIEW7.0 Express。LabVIEW程序分为前面板和程序框图两部分。前面板是用户接口,以数字或图形等各种形式输出测试结果,面板上有表头、按钮、拨盘、指示灯、温度计等。程序框图是程序的源代码,不需要文本编程就可以实现所见即所得的程序。

采用LabVIEW编程,前面板的控件、指示件和程序框图中的端子对应起来,通过修改控件或者程序框图就会在相应的程序框图或者控件上有实时的更新。

LabVIEW7.0及之后版本可以采用数据采集助手(DAQ Assistant)进行交互式配置和代码生成,与NI-DAQ绑定的DAQ Assistant提供对话框向导逐步的引导用户完成整个配置、测试以及编程测量任务,在大多数常用量的测量上,很多都已经在采集函数上集成。比如测量温度的热电偶的型号在软件中已经集成,只要用户选择设置型号和冷端补偿方式及相应的常数,就可以直接得到实际的温度值。

在本设计中,把要采集的温度、湿度、压力、电流、电压及开关输入、输出量等参数各采用一个数据采集助手,实现各个通道的并行执行,并连同有关的滤波、变换、放大、保存、显示等数据处理放在同一个WHILE循环中实现连续的采样和数据采集处理、并通过图形界面形象的表示出来,使实验者对空调的各项参数一目了然。

来源:今日电子   作者:珠海格力电器股份有限公司 黄炳南 冯海杰  2005/10/1 0:00:00
栏目: [ ]

相关阅读

安森美推出新的高功率图腾柱PFC控制器,满足具挑战的能效标准

动态功耗低至60μA/MHz!助力设备超长续航,首选国民技术低功耗MCU!